Australian passport

Australian Passport

In 1917 were released the first Australian passports – X Series. During the First World War passports helped to identify and keep track of soldiers crossing the borders of different countries.

Phrase «Australian Passport» appeared on the passport only in 1949, and before that used the inscription «British Passport». In the same year were released two series passports – «B Series» for use in Australia by the citizens of the UK and «C Series» only for citizens of Australia.

Queensland

Queensland on the mapQueensland is a state in the north-eastern mainland of Australia. Population is 3.94 million people (third place among states in the country). The capital and the largest city is Brisbane. Official name is «Sunshine State» and «Smart State».

The first settlers in the region were the Australian Aborigines and Torres Strait Islanders, who arrived here, according to various dating methods about 40000 – 65000 years ago. Later, after the arrival of European colonists in Queensland was established British colony, which became a separate administrative-territorial unit at June 6, 1859. This date is now celebrated annually as The Queensland Day.

The territory which is now occupied by the Brisbane, was originally a colony of Moreton Bay, designed to link back-convicted offenders who have committed a second offense in exile in New South Wales. Later, the state government began to encourage the establishment of the free settlement that today has led to the development of agriculture, tourism and natural resources.

Most of the state's population lives in South-East Queensland, which include the capital Brisbane, Logan City, Redland City, Ipswich, Toowoomba and the Gold Coast and Sunshine Coast. Other important regional centers: Cairns, Townsville, Mackay, Rockhampton, Bundaberg, Harvey Bay, Ingem and Mount Isa.

Informal name of the residents of Queensland is "Banana Benders", probably comes from the huge number of banana plantations in the tropics of the state.

Prehistoric Australia

Prehistoric era of Australia is the time period from the date of arrival in Australia of the first people up to their first encounter with Europeans in 1606, when recorded history begins in Australia. According to various estimates, Prehistory of Australia went from 40 to 70 thousand years.

Arrival people in Australia

Australian_Coat_of_ArmsThe general opinion of historians, a man arrived in Australia no later than 40 thousand years ago – this time include traces of man discovered in the Upper Swan, Western Australia. In Tasmania, which was then connected to the mainland by a land bridge, a man fell at least 30,000 years ago.

There are also more bold predictions about the time of appearance of the first people in Australia. Thus, the analysis of ancient pollen from the south-eastern Australia indicates an increase in fires, dating from about 120,000 years ago. Individual researchers attributed these fires to human activity, calling into question their dating. Charles Dortch dating stone tools found at Rottnest, about 70000 years ago. In general, researchers are dating, more than 40,000 years, with skepticism.

Human migration to Australia occurred in the final stages of the Pleistocene, when sea level was much lower than the modern. Repeated glaciation in the Pleistocene led to the sea level during the last glacial maximum in Australasia has been more than 100 meters below the current one. At this time, the continental coast stretched much further, covering the Timor Sea, so that Australia and New Guinea formed a single continent known as Sahul, connecting land by an isthmus, which took place on the waters of the current Arafura Sea, Gulf of Carpentaria and the Torres Strait. Despite this, sea and in those days was a significant barrier to travel, so it is assumed that the first humans came to Australia, swimming across short distances from island to island. Offered two hypothetical route of this migration: one – the chain of small islands between Sulawesi and New Guinea, and the second – in the north-west Australia via Timor.

AustraliaAustralia hosted the program "Work and Study in Australia". This program provides an opportunity to significantly improve their knowledge of English, its Australian version, as well as during the study provides a paid job. That is, for this program, you get to combine study and work. For the Russians, who participate in the program "Work and Study in Australia" are allowed to work in Australia not more than 20 hours per week. Duration of the program "Work and Study in Australia" depends on the payment. You can work and learn in this state that the term for which you paid. But it must be at least 3 months. Requirements for participants of the program are pretty simple: age at least 18 years of age and English proficiency in the amount not less than the Intermediate General English.
